CPSC recall 11207
Toro Power Clear Snowblower and the Toro 20" Recycler Mower
- CPSC
- unknown
- Published 2016-06-07
On 2016-06-07 the CPSC announced a recall of Toro Power Clear Snowblower and the Toro 20" Recycler Mower by The Toro, citing the carburetors on both products develop fuel leaks and can ignite when exposed to an ignition source, posing a fire or burn hazard.

Product
Toro Power Clear Snowblower and the Toro 20" Recycler Mower | Toro PC-421Q Snowblowers: The model/serial numbers are found on a decal on the underside of the rear of the unit. Model and serial numbers are: Model Number Serial Number 38588 310000001 to 310999999 and 311000001 to 311003576 38589 310000001 to 310999999 and 311000001 to 311999999 Toro 20" Recycler Mower: The model and serial numbers are found on a decal on the left rear of the mower. Model 20323; Serial number 310000001 to 310999999.
Reason
The carburetors on both products develop fuel leaks and can ignite when exposed to an ignition source, posing a fire or burn hazard.
